What Represents 11-52-0 Plant Food? A Detailed Guide

11-52-0 fertilizer is a unique kind of blend primarily used to encourage phosphorus absorption in growth. The numbers, 11-52-0, show the percentage by weight of nitrogen, phosphorus, and K2O, respectively. Essentially, it contains 11% nitrogen, a substantial 52% P, and 0% potassium. This phosphorus-rich content makes it particularly valuable for establishing young plants and rectifying P lack in the ground. While it offers significant benefits, remember that it lacks potassium, so a balanced fertilizer may be needed for overall vegetation health.

Monoammonium Phosphate {11-52-0: Your Questions Addressed

Many farmers have queries about MAP, particularly regarding its make-up of 11-52-0. Essentially, this indicates the percentage of N, P2O5, and potash respectively. It’s a highly easily dissolved source of phosphorus, crucial for root development and blooming. Here's some common topics:

  • What is the upside of using MAP? MAP offers a concentrated dose of phosphorus, which is be particularly beneficial in soils deficient in phosphorus.
  • How should apply MAP? It’s typically applied and worked into the soil, or used in fertigation systems.
  • Can combine MAP with other products? While mixable with some, thoroughly check interactions to avoid problems.
